CVE-2022-50594 Advantech iView < v5.7.04 Build 6425 data Parameter SQL Injection Information Disclosure
Advantech iView versions prior to v5.7.04 build 6425 contain a vulnerability within the SNMP management tool that allows for remote attackers to bypass authentication checks and reach a SQL injection vulnerability within the ‘data’ parameter to the ‘NetworkServlet’ endpoint. HTML Injection
mailgen is vulnerable to HTML injection. The vulnerability is due to improper sanitization of user-supplied content and Mailgen.generatePlaintextemail retaining HTML tags from input. An attacker can supply crafted content to inject HTML into generated plaintext emails...
